SAN FRANCISCO, Calif., March 24, 2015 (SEND2PRESS NEWSWIRE) -- San Francisco based artist John Waguespack unveils a new chapter in his creative evolution in 'Channeling the Dionysian,' a solo exhibition at Rocha Art. In his first solo exhibition in over a year, Waguespack's work is inspired by Friedrich Nietzsche's dramatic theory of the 'Dionysian' and 'Apollonian' modes of the human mind.

‘Mark Felt, Superstar’ is a New Musical About Watergate’s Deep Throat – Coming to the Triad Theater

NEW YORK, N.Y., March 9, 2015 (SEND2PRESS NEWSWIRE) -- The Triad Theater will present the first New York performances of 'Mark Felt, Superstar,' a new musical about Watergate's infamous Deep Throat, with book, music and lyrics by Joshua Rosenblum. Though his name is little known today, Mark Felt was the retired FBI man who revealed in 2005 that he had been Deep Throat, the secret source for journalists Woodward and Bernstein during the Watergate era.
